In this episode, we explore what it truly means to grow spiritually. Drawing from 1 Peter 2:1–2 and Ephesians 4:11–16, we learn that spiritual growth is not optional—it’s God’s desire for every believer. Growth involves putting away sin, desiring God’s Word, and maturing in both character and spiritual gifts.We emphasize that growth does not happen in isolation. God has designed the local church as the primary environment for spiritual development. Through the gifts and graces placed within the church—apostles, prophets, teachers, and more—believers are equipped, strengthened, and built up together.This episode highlights:The call to grow in faith, character, and spiritual giftsThe importance of the local church as God’s plan for your developmentHow every believer has a role and supply that contributes to the growth of othersThe power and presence of the Holy Spirit within the church communityWhy spiritual maturity comes through participation, unity, and active engagementUltimately, we are reminded that God has already supplied everything we need for growth. As we commit to learning, praying, and functioning within the local church, we experience His power, walk in our inheritance, and grow into the fullness of Christ.
